You might want to check out FocalPoint II. I use it and am very pleased with it. It has daily and monthly calendars, plus and to-do list for items and phone calls. There are also other categories, such as project/client/vendor info, expenses, time cards, rolex, and notes. It works with Hypercard 1.25. It's made by TenPoint. I haven't used any other packages of this nature, but am very pleased with Focal Point. C. Aclin
